‘I Have a Lot to Say’: Brain Implant Helps a Disabled Patient Speak

Monday, September 14, 2026


A company announced that its wireless brain-computer interface device enabled a patient to produce speech by imagining words without physically speaking them. The technology marks a development in brain implant systems designed to restore communication for people with speech disabilities. The patient's ability to generate words through the device was demonstrated, according to the company's statement.
